Post by ᴛᴜᴇsᴅᴀʏ on Jul 6, 2017 20:23:27 GMT -5
oh my goodness, dew. ;w; i hope you know i reread this like, three times to get it to sink in.
but thank you so much!! i'm pretty sure you've seen me say before that htmf is my fic baby, and everything i have has been invested in bringing this fic to life as well as i can. i'm actually most thrilled that you love coal and stone so much, though. stone is based off an oc i've had for nearly six years, and she's grown into so many shapes, but this might be the one that suits her best because i get to show her being selfish and snappish even as she gets to be full of compassion and understanding. as for coal, he and his brother are lowkey based on one of my favorite duos in animation, but most of the similarities end at their brotherhood and their lost parents. everything else about them took a life of its own, and coal has rapidly become one of my dearest characters. there's something fragile about him that takes care to write, and at the same time, he's got this tough shell that's the only thing that's kept him and clay alive so long. his guarded heart is my favorite part of him, to the point that i know pretty well which songs i would put on a playlist for him (which...may happen in a special thread soon... [winks loudly]).
but again, thank you so much. ♥ this makes me so happy, and i'm so glad you're enjoying it so far. if you don't mind me asking, where are you at? what's your favorite part so far? (and if you have a favorite line...i'd love to know lol)
